Fancy driving Hyundai’s Hydrogen ix35 Fuel Cell?
Fri, 05 Oct 2012As part of the European Hydrogen Road Tour, Hyundai are offering members of the public the chance to drive the ix35 FCEV. As we revealed back in August, the Hyundai ix35 FCEV – Hyundai’s hydrogen-powered electric ix35 – is going in to production before the end of 2012, the first proper production fuel cell vehicle…in the world. The initial production run is small – just 1,000 cars – but Hyundai are planning to put the ix35 FCEV in to full production by 2015, by which time they’re hoping there will be a viable hydrogen refuelling infrastructure in place.

GM closes UK Advanced Design Studio
Tue, 09 Aug 2011CDN has learnt that General Motors is closing its UK Advanced Design Studio as part of its ongoing restructuring program. Clay Dean, GM's executive director of advanced global design and Cadillac's brand director, arrived at the studio on 4 August to announce the closure to staff. The UK studio, which opened in 1999, was predominantly involved in the creation of Cadillac concept cars and was originally planned to be a short-term confidential operation as the smallest of GM's design studios.
